Adobe recently made waves in the tech world by announcing the much-anticipated release of Photoshop for the iPad. This move has been eagerly awaited by creative professionals and enthusiasts alike, who have long hoped for a mobile version of the popular image editing software.
Fans of Photoshop can rejoice, as Adobe has confirmed that the iPad version of the software is set to be released in the fall of 2019. This is exciting news for those who rely on Photoshop for their professional and personal projects, as it will bring the powerful editing capabilities of the desktop version to a more portable and touch-friendly platform.
The arrival of Photoshop on the iPad marks a significant step forward in Adobe's efforts to make its software more accessible and user-friendly across different devices. With this new version, users will be able to seamlessly transition their projects between the iPad and desktop, thanks to the integration of Adobe's Creative Cloud services.
One of the key highlights of Photoshop for the iPad is its redesigned interface, which has been optimized for touch interactions. This means that users will be able to perform tasks such as editing photos, creating digital artwork, and applying filters and effects with ease using their fingertips.
Furthermore, Adobe has incorporated many familiar features from the desktop version of Photoshop into the iPad app, ensuring that users will have access to a robust set of tools and functionalities. From advanced layer editing to precise selection tools, the iPad version aims to deliver a comprehensive editing experience for users on the go.
In addition to its powerful editing capabilities, Photoshop for the iPad also offers seamless integration with Apple Pencil, allowing users to take advantage of the precision and control that the stylus provides. This feature will be particularly appealing to artists and designers who rely on pen input for their creative work.
Adobe has also emphasized the performance optimization of Photoshop for the iPad, ensuring that the software runs smoothly and efficiently on Apple's hardware. This focus on performance will enable users to work on complex projects without experiencing any lag or slowdown, providing a seamless editing experience.
